Struct aws_sdk_sagemaker::model::ModelMetrics
source · [−]#[non_exhaustive]pub struct ModelMetrics {
pub model_quality: Option<ModelQuality>,
pub model_data_quality: Option<ModelDataQuality>,
pub bias: Option<Bias>,
pub explainability: Option<Explainability>,
}
Expand description
Contains metrics captured from a model.
Fields (Non-exhaustive)
This struct is marked as non-exhaustive
Struct { .. }
syntax; cannot be matched against without a wildcard ..
; and struct update syntax will not work.model_quality: Option<ModelQuality>
Metrics that measure the quality of a model.
model_data_quality: Option<ModelDataQuality>
Metrics that measure the quality of the input data for a model.
bias: Option<Bias>
Metrics that measure bais in a model.
explainability: Option<Explainability>
Metrics that help explain a model.
